The discriminant is the following equation:

[tex]b^{2} -4ac[/tex]

You just simply plug in the values of the coefficients.

[tex]0=x^{2} -2x+5[/tex]

a = 1 (first terms coefficient)

b = -2 (second terms coefficient)

c = 5 (last terms coefficient)
